ER15M123JR

Gowanda’s ER15M123JR is a high-quality, reliable electronic component, specifically a M39010 Level-R Molded Unshielded Inductor. It features a compact design with dimensions of 9.27 × 3.71 × 3.71 mm and a weight of 0.85 g. This inductor belongs to the ER15M series and is designed for through-hole technology (THT) mounting. It is suitable for QPL application grades, offering an inductance of 120 µH, a direct current resistance (DCR) of 5.2 Ω, and a current rating of 124 A DC. The inductor operates at a self-resonant frequency (SRF) of 8.7 MHz, with a test frequency of 0.79 MHz and a minimum quality factor (Q MIN) of 65. It is built to withstand dielectric withstanding voltages (DWV) of 1000 and 300, with a tolerance of ±5%. The product is classified as Level R, Class 1, and features a Pb termination type with a Sn63Pb37 finish. Constructed with a powdered iron core, it is not shielded and operates within a temperature range of -55°C to +105°C. The component has a moisture sensitivity level (MSL) of 1 and is packaged in tape and reel (T&R) format, though it is not fungal inert.
